With our 1 year old baby boy, we spent 10 days at the Fattoria. It's true you don't have the accomodation of a 5* hotel but this not what we looked for, we wanted to discover Tuscany. If you're lookin for the same thing, this is the place you need to go to. The views from the fattoria are breathtaking, each night my wife and I spent some time on the hill, in the garden, just contemplating all that beauty (with some local wine, of course). Swimming pool is perfect, great also to have an area at the pool dedicated to kids. Rooms are very typical, we found this charming! You have close to everything you need.
Location is also a big +, 15min from Florence and within 30 min you can reach Siena/S Gimignano.

We were welcomed by Ivana. She was very helpful and kind. Simply impossible for us to understand some reviews where people talked about being rude. Probably a misunderstanding!

This is a place we fell in love with! We will, for sure, come back in the future.

Maybe a (tiny) remark, we found the breakfast ok with fresh fruit, yoghurts, bread etc but this could be improved (with very few implications) by offering eggs in the morning. Also the coffee, where in the world can you drink better coffee than in Italy?, was not that great.
This is really the only minus we could come up with!

Some reviews are just not honest (otherwise la Loggia would be at the top of the list in S Casciano) but this is fine for us, not too many people should know about this pearl otherwise booking might become tough in the future :-)

We stayed at La Loggia for 10 days; it was our base of operations for our tour of Tuscany. We were so happy each day to return to its beautiful tranquility after a a manic day of touristing. Ivana, the manager was really nice and helpful and took care all of our 'dumb tourist' problems with a smile. The apartment was rustic and cozy, comfortable and clean with all of the amenities, and delicious fresh breakfast was delivered to our door every day. The location was perfect for day trips to Florence, Siena, Chianti wine country and the hill towns, and the local restaurants were fantastic. We couldn't have been happier with our stay, it is a sublimely beautiful spot and they make good wine too!

Room Tip: You will want a view of the vineyard

Went here with husband, parents, and brother, and stayed in 3 different rooms on the property. This place is very charming and the views are gorgeous. There is not much nearby, which is the point to a place like this. The rooms were very spacious and rustically charming. They include small kitchenettes and in some cases a good size kitchen. The vineyards and olive trees on the property were beautiful and accessible. The breakfast is great. The woman who runs the property is very nice and helpful. We signed up for the olive oil and wine tasting sessions- very delicious and informative. There are small towns nearby with a grocery store, laundry, and restaurants. There is a restaurant recommendation list and wines in every room. A car is a must.
